|
Не отрабатывается параметр в функции
|
|||
---|---|---|---|
#18+
Predeclared, Проверила в Acc2003. 1. Если флажок связан с логическим полем таблицы, не имеющим значения по умолчанию, и флажок тоже не имеет значения по умолчанию, то пустое значение воспринимается как False, не как Null, ошибка Invalid use of Null не возникает. 2. Если же флажок свободен, то есть не привязан к полю таблицы, то при отсутствии значения по умолчанию изначально он Null, попытка использовать его без Nz(...) приводит к ошибке Invalid use of Null. ... |
|||
:
Нравится:
Не нравится:
|
|||
16.11.2015, 00:59 |
|
Не отрабатывается параметр в функции
|
|||
---|---|---|---|
#18+
Проверил на рабочей машине (A2003 sp3) свободный флажок: С явным описанием .Value ошибки Invalid use of Null нет. ... |
|||
:
Нравится:
Не нравится:
|
|||
16.11.2015, 09:23 |
|
Не отрабатывается параметр в функции
|
|||
---|---|---|---|
#18+
Predeclared, Да. Вы абсолютно правы.р Вчера второпях забыла Value. И в 2003-м, и в 97-м Invalid use of Null не возникает при наличии Value. Пустое значение распознается как False. Получается, умолчания не всегда полностью идентичны полной записи. ... |
|||
:
Нравится:
Не нравится:
|
|||
16.11.2015, 10:58 |
|
Не отрабатывается параметр в функции
|
|||
---|---|---|---|
#18+
__Michelle... Пустое значение распознается как False... Я бы уточнил: НЕ распознается как True. :) ... |
|||
:
Нравится:
Не нравится:
|
|||
16.11.2015, 11:30 |
|
|
start [/forum/topic.php?fid=45&startmsg=39104023&tid=1614283]: |
0ms |
get settings: |
8ms |
get forum list: |
14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
51ms |
get topic data: |
11ms |
get forum data: |
3ms |
get page messages: |
44ms |
get tp. blocked users: |
2ms |
others: | 321ms |
total: | 462ms |
0 / 0 |